Understanding the Types of Removals Vans Available in the UK

When it comes to moving house, one of the most crucial decisions you’ll make is choosing the right removals van. It’s not just about having a vehicle to haul your stuff; it’s about finding the perfect fit for your needs. So, let’s dive into the various types of removals vans available in the UK and what each one brings to the table.


1. Transit Vans: The All-Rounders


Transit vans are the bread and butter of the removals world. They’re versatile, reliable, and can handle a decent load. Typically, they come in various sizes, from small to large, making them suitable for everything from studio flats to modest family homes.


Their flat loading area allows for easy access to your belongings, and many come equipped with tie-down points to keep your items secure during transit. If you’re looking for a well-rounded option that can adapt to most moving scenarios, a transit van is a solid choice.


2. Luton Vans: The Heavyweights


If you’ve got a lot of larger items, think sofas, wardrobes, or that ridiculously heavy antique piano that you just had to keep, then a Luton van is your best mate. These vans have a boxy shape, providing a generous amount of space and a low loading height, which makes loading and unloading a doddle.


Luton vans often come with a tail lift, which is a lifesaver for moving heavy items without breaking your back. They’re ideal for larger removals or if you’re moving from a big property.


3. Box Vans: The Spacious Option


Box vans are similar to Luton vans but usually feature a completely enclosed cargo area. This means your belongings are protected from the elements and prying eyes, making it an excellent choice for long-distance moves or if you’re worried about your stuff getting wet.


They come in various sizes, so whether you’re moving a few boxes or an entire house, there’s likely a box van that fits the bill. Just remember that their bulkier size may require some careful manoeuvring when navigating tighter streets.


4. Small Vans: Perfect for Studio Flats


If you’re moving out of a small flat or just have a few bits and bobs to transport, a small van is all you need. These pint-sized powerhouses are perfect for quick moves, and you won’t have to worry about wasting fuel on a bigger vehicle.


While they don’t have the capacity of their larger cousins, small vans are often easier to park and navigate through crowded urban areas. If you’re only moving a handful of boxes and a couple of pieces of furniture, a small van might be the way to go.


5. Tipper Vans: For the DIY Projects


Now, if you’re not moving house but have a garden project or some construction waste to clear, a tipper van is your best bet. These vans have an open back with a hydraulic lift, making it easy to load and unload heavy materials like soil, gravel, or debris.


While they’re not typically used for house removals, they can be invaluable for garden makeovers or DIY renovations. Just make sure you’re not trying to squeeze your grandmother’s armchair in there!


6. Flatbed Vans: The Heavy-Duty Movers


Flatbed vans are more suited for transporting large goods or machinery rather than household items. With no sides or roof, they provide a large flat surface for oversized items.


These vans are often used by businesses for deliveries but can also be handy if you’re moving something particularly large or awkward. Just keep in mind that your belongings will be exposed to the elements, so they’re not the best choice for a typical house move.


Final Thoughts: Choosing the Right Van for Your Move


When it comes to selecting the right removals van, consider the size of your load, the distance of your move, and the types of items you’re transporting. Whether you go for a trusty transit van, a spacious Luton, or a pint-sized small van, the key is to match the vehicle to your specific needs.
